H.Con.Res. 695 (93rd)
Concurrent resolution to provide for the creation of an independent commission to raise charitable contributions for, and to construct, a statue of peace.

Summary
Authorizes the President to issue a proclamation and order creating a private nonprofit commission for the purpose of constructing and maintaining a "Statue of Peace" as a tribute to, and memorial of, United States-Asian cooperation. States that such commission shall be authorized to solicit and receive gifts, donations, and bequests, to select and acquire a site for the statue on the west coast of the United States, and to review and select from among various designs for such a statue.
